Wombat Hill Botanic Gardens
Some booking links are affiliate links. If you book through them, we may earn a small commission at no extra cost to you. We never let this influence which places we recommend.
Wombat Hill Botanic Gardens sit on the rim of an extinct volcano, offering sweeping views of the Daylesford region. Established in the 1860s, these gardens feature mature trees, a fernery, and a network of walking paths. Visitors can explore the rhododendron dell, the giant redwood, and the historic rotunda. The elevated position provides a cool retreat and photo opportunities over the surrounding countryside.
Don't miss
- Panoramic views from the volcano rim
- Historic fernery with tree ferns
- Giant redwood tree and rhododendron dell
